"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League Early Access Review and In-Game Currency Gift"

TL;DR Summary
Rocksteady has given 2000 LuthorCoins of in-game currency, valued at around £16, to owners of the £100 deluxe edition of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League as a gesture of appreciation for their patience during repeated server downtime. The deluxe edition promised early access to the game, but server issues have caused disruptions, prompting the developer to compensate players.
